Twelve p.c of US adults have taken a GLP-1 agonist—an more and more standard kind of prescription drug for weight problems and diabetes administration, that features standard manufacturers like Ozempic and Mounjaro.
Australia’s Therapeutic Items Administration lately accredited the kind 2 diabetes drug tirzepatide (offered as Mounjaro) to be used in treating weight problems, resulting in a nationwide scarcity.
Tirzepatide and different GLP-1 agonists mimic hormones which might be naturally launched after consuming, which assist to manage blood sugar and sign fullness to the mind.
Whereas this explains a part of their impact, researchers nonetheless do not absolutely perceive how they alter consuming habits and result in vital weight reduction in most people that take them.
Some folks report that their intrusive ideas round meals—generally known as “meals noise” on social media—have disappeared after they began taking these medication.
Though there is not a lot empirical proof for this, these reviews have led scientists to hypothesize that these medicines act past the intestine, and goal circuits within the mind that management how we course of rewards and hunt down aid for our cravings.
Making sense of binge consuming dysfunction
Binge consuming dysfunction (BED) is essentially the most prevalent consuming dysfunction in Australia.
These affected with binge consuming dysfunction devour extreme quantities of meals quickly, usually consuming previous fullness and into bodily discomfort. Emotions of guilt and disgrace comply with, additional entrenching this damaging cycle and making binge consuming dysfunction tougher to deal with.
Binge consuming dysfunction is strongly related to weight acquire and weight problems, although not all people with weight problems have BED. Analysis signifies that BED is extra prevalent amongst people with weight problems, and it usually co-occurs with different medical circumstances like kind 2 diabetes and heart problems.
The causes of binge consuming dysfunction stay unsure, however proof suggests it’s pushed by compulsive neural mechanisms—the identical mind pathways that regulate behavior formation and dependancy.
Ideally, GLP-1 medicines might assist folks dwelling with binge consuming dysfunction (BED) to interrupt this cycle by lowering their overwhelming intrusive ideas round consuming and empowering them to normalize their relationship with meals.
GLP-1 agonists should not at present indicated for the remedy of binge consuming dysfunction (BED).
Though there’s some very early proof suggesting that these medicines may assist cut back the frequency or depth of binge consuming episodes, no large-scale medical trials have been accomplished to substantiate their security or effectiveness for this situation.
That is why GLP-1s can’t be routinely prescribed for BED and why extra analysis is required earlier than they are often thought-about a viable remedy choice.
Nevertheless, these medicines also can trigger folks to skip meals and to really feel much less in contact with their very own pure starvation cues, a very troubling concern for these dwelling with an consuming dysfunction.
An overemphasis on weight and form might come up in some folks as they start to expertise adjustments to their physique form and weight.
Equally, these in restoration might battle to face the uncomfortable emotions that binging helped them to deal with, together with previous traumas and experiences of fatphobia.
For these causes, I’m cautious of those medication being seen as a remedy for binge consuming dysfunction; though they might ultimately show to be efficient at lowering the frequency of binge consuming episodes, I don’t consider a treatment ought to be perceived as an alternative choice to psychotherapy.
Maybe the best trigger for concern is just not what occurs to folks with binge consuming dysfunction after they begin taking the GLP-1 medicines, however somewhat, what occurs in the event that they cease.
Individuals who cease taking medication like Ozempic are recognized to regain the load they misplaced whereas on the drug and it’s nonetheless unknown how folks with BED’s temper or compulsions to binge eat might shift in the event that they cease utilizing of those medicines.
One month’s dose of tirzepatide can price over AU$700 with a non-public prescription, which means that individuals with restricted financial sources might not have the ability to afford the long-term use of a drug they profit from.
Financial precarity and meals insecurity have each been discovered to be threat elements for binge consuming dysfunction, which means that those that might stand to profit essentially the most from potential new interventions might not have the ability to afford them.
A brand new examine led by my crew on the College of Melbourne goals to check the idea that these medication can break the cycle of binge consuming by monitoring how GLP-1 medication change the brains of individuals dwelling with BED.
For this examine, adults with BED will full an MRI scan proper earlier than they start taking a GLP-1 treatment and after taking the drug for six months.
The problems above, amongst many others, have led us to include a number of precautionary measures into our examine design. For instance, all individuals with BED will even obtain common help from a medical psychologist all through the 6-month examine interval to deal with any misery which will come up.
We predict it’s important that we offer individuals with complete psychoeducation to grasp and handle the results of the treatment earlier than they enroll, particularly to organize them for the conclusion of the examine.
Nevertheless, if the general public’s pleasure round GLP-1 medicines will get forward of the science, probably harmful situations might seem wherein a rising variety of folks with binge consuming dysfunction start taking them for off-label use.
All of the extra cause to grasp how these medication affect the mind and to ascertain an knowledgeable basis for the event of focused and efficient remedies for the world’s commonest consuming dysfunction.
